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Высокое значение CPU сервера  [new]
RasimS
Member

Откуда: SPB
Сообщений: 954
Добрый день. После того, как поставил апдейты винды Win 2012 R2 standart появилось постоянно высокое значение CPU MS sql server. Доходит до 100% загрузки
Версия Microsoft SQL Server 2014 - 12.0.2000.8 (X64)
Feb 20 2014 20:04:26
Copyright (c) Microsoft Corporation
Enterprise Edition (64-bit) on Windows NT 6.3 <X64> (Build 9600: )

Подскажите, как быть?
25 янв 16, 16:31    [18726892]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
Glory
Member

Откуда:
Сообщений: 104760
RasimS
Подскажите, как быть?

Никак не быть
Кто-то жалуется на что-то конкретное ?
25 янв 16, 16:35    [18726923]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
RasimS
Member

Откуда: SPB
Сообщений: 954
Glory
RasimS
Подскажите, как быть?

Никак не быть
Кто-то жалуется на что-то конкретное ?

Все висит от этого. Перезугружаю сервер все ок. И потом снова 100%
25 янв 16, 16:47    [18726985]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
Glory
Member

Откуда:
Сообщений: 104760
RasimS
Все висит от этого.

Как может висеть все, если кто-то использует процессор

RasimS
Перезугружаю сервер все ок.

Руки поотрывать бы

RasimS
И потом снова 100%

Потому, что кто-то сначала начал транзакцию. Потом опомнился и отменил ее.
А теперь сервер вынужден отменять транзакцию. Причем после каждой перезагрузки он вынужден делать это с самого начала.
25 янв 16, 16:50    [18727005]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
RasimS
Member

Откуда: SPB
Сообщений: 954
Glory, Сама логика не менялась до накатки апдейтов и после. Скажите, как можно промониторить данную ситуацию?
25 янв 16, 16:55    [18727049]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
Glory
Member

Откуда:
Сообщений: 104760
RasimS
Сама логика не менялась до накатки апдейтов и после.

Какая еще логика ? Какие апдейты ?

RasimS
Скажите, как можно промониторить данную ситуацию?

Подсоединиться к серверу и помониторить - лог, коннекты, их состояние
25 янв 16, 16:57    [18727064]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
a_voronin
Member

Откуда: Москва
Сообщений: 4804
RasimS,

Вы статистику обновляли после наката обновлений?

https://msdn.microsoft.com/en-us/library/ms173804.aspx
25 янв 16, 16:59    [18727077]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
RasimS
Member

Откуда: SPB
Сообщений: 954
a_voronin
RasimS,

Вы статистику обновляли после наката обновлений?

https://msdn.microsoft.com/en-us/library/ms173804.aspx

Статистику сразу же обновил.
25 янв 16, 17:16    [18727158]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
RasimS
Member

Откуда: SPB
Сообщений: 954
Какая еще логика ? Какие апдейты ?
апдейты винды. Ничего не делалось с сервером и хранимками. До этого нагрузка была примерно 5% сейчас под 100%
25 янв 16, 17:17    [18727171]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
Glory
Member

Откуда:
Сообщений: 104760
RasimS
Ничего не делалось с сервером и хранимками.

Ну разумеется. И даже пользователи не создавали соединения и не запускали запросы.
Сервер сам вдруг стал дял себя лично использовать 100% процессора
25 янв 16, 17:19    [18727176]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
o-o
Guest
RasimS
До этого нагрузка была примерно 5% сейчас под 100%

вам так трудно помониторить, что сервер выполняет?
вы не знаете, какую и кто диверсию мог устроить и за что.
у меня недавно мелькала идея повесить что-либо вендикативное на определенные DDL-события.
как раз выбор был: то ли процессор им завесить по методу 17183330,
то ли рандомную таблицу в рандомной же базе дропать.
в процедуре активации (SS Broker) на каждый ALTER PROC.
еще показалось, что "процессорный" вариант больно легко отлавливается
в отличие от моментального дропа.
а вот и нет.
людям же лень мониторить
25 янв 16, 17:43    [18727275]     Ответить | Цитировать Сообщить модератору
 Re: Высокое значение CPU сервера  [new]
Владислав Колосов
Member

Откуда:
Сообщений: 7868
RasimS
Какая еще логика ? Какие апдейты ?
апдейты винды. Ничего не делалось с сервером и хранимками. До этого нагрузка была примерно 5% сейчас под 100%


.NET перекомпилируется. Не паникуйте, подождите несколько часов. Наверняка это не сиквел 100% занимает.
25 янв 16, 18:29    [18727493]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ить